    As the saying goes, the master is in the folk, and there are too many good calligraphy in China, but there are very few people who can become famous and sell for a price. Many street performers can write beautiful and atmospheric characters, but these people can only perform on the streets, and well-known calligraphers can sell a pair of characters to a very high level. This is because real talent and hard work are only one aspect, and it is very important to be famous, you can only be willing to spend ** money to buy your works if you have fame first, so people who spend money are not only buying your words, but also buying your name.

    There is no such thing as art, as long as the buyer likes your work, then how much money he pays is reasonable. In fact, many well-known artists were poor during their lifetimes, and some even sold their works on the street but still struggled to survive, because their works were not appreciated by the people of that era, so naturally they had no value at all. It's like the famous painter Picasso, he was a genius in painting, but he was not famous when he was alive, and some of his paintings were not even bought.

    It was only after his death that his abstract school was accepted by the world. Therefore, he can be said to be the originator of abstract painting.

    There is also Qi Baishi, a famous painter in my country, who also made a living by selling paintings when he was young. He didn't become famous until he was old, so many of the paintings he used to paint were sold at a very low **. And now, there are many paintings of Qi Baishi that can no longer be found.

    It can be said that a painting is hard to find, so his paintings have become something that the rich compete for. There are many people who are willing to pay millions for one of his paintings.

    Therefore, art itself is priceless, and no matter how good your work is, it must be recognized by the world before it can become something valuable.

    In our daily life, we often encounter things, in the square, in the bustling streets, often meet some elders, with chalk on the ground to write artistic fonts, many people are attracted by such a move, stop **, the writer on the ground put a small piece of paper, or plastic together, etc., use this way to seek charity!

    First of all, I am in awe of these people who are writing and begging on the side of the road, it can be said that they are not begging, just like the ancient rivers and lakes, I think these "beggars" who write on the street are not beggars strictly speaking, they are a kind of street art, and the principle of selling words is the same, but the occasion is different, they all rely on their ability to eat.

    Now the calligraphy and painting market is not sluggish, there are fewer and fewer people who have spare money to buy calligraphy and paintings, many calligraphers and painters can not find a market, some galleries are selling calligraphy and painting works at a very cheap **, there are very few calligraphers who simply rely on selling calligraphy and painting to eat, they all have their own jobs, calligraphy and painting is just a hobby, and can not bring a lot of income, and the "beggars" of street art are directly facing the market, facing customers with small profits and quick turnover, but can rely on writing to maintain their lives. This is definitely more profitable than just begging.

    Such wandering artists often have solid basic skills, but there are not many people who really rely on calligraphy to make a living after all.

    In recent years, it is indeed rare for artists to write on the streets, but in previous years, it is common to see street artists writing scenes, especially in places like our Xi'an Academy, Big Wild Goose Pagoda Square, Tang West Market, Baxian Nunnery and other places, it is easy to see street artists performing and writing there.

    They can't work like normal people, so they can only practice the craft of writing and go to the streets to support their families. They wrote in two ways, one was to write on the sidewalk with colored chalk, mostly in imitation Song script or other regular scripts, and the content was mostly about their family history or encounters.
